Every once in a while I'm hearing a squeek from port engine when it is in gear. I've heard this from several boats over the years. It goes away pretty quick as soon as you increase RPM. I talked to one guy who thought it might just be some junk ie seaweed up in the bearing and he has heard it before on different boats that it was no big deal.

Anyone else have any experience, is there a clear indication if you have a bearing going south. Last guy to change my prop's said all bearing's looked good and as far as he could see shafts were fine etc..

I would guess you have an alignment problem. I had the squeak when drifting after putting the transmission in neutral. I corrected the shaft/engine alignment and the squeak stopped. Good Luck
